    The study on the effect of ACN exposure on the expression of p53 and p21WAF1 proteins in vitro and in vivo. The study group consisted of 49 subjects exposed to ACN in the petrochemical industry. Subjects living in the same area but not working in this factory were used as controls. No significant differences in either p53, or p21WAF1 levels between the exposed and control groups were found. Also no effect of GSTM1 and GSTT1 genotypes was observed.
